      Hi, new here 🙂
      I am following UT for a while now and I am running it on my old Nexus 5 for testing and playing around with it. My main phone right now is a Moto G7, which I am running completely degoogled with LineageOS and MicroG. While I'm quite happy with this setup at the moment, I'd be interested in trying to port UT to it... But for this to happen and to invest my time, I'd need to know if I can use UT as a daily driver. Some of the apps I rely on heavily e.g. are keepass and a 2FA/OTP generator. On the G7 I use KeePassDX and andOTP for these. I haven't found reliable alternatives on the UT OpenStore yet however. All the keepass apps I found don't seem to work correctly. For OTP, I am looking for an app that ideally lets me import json backups from andOTP, since I have a lot of entries that I don't want having to reenter one by one - the only app I found on UT that allows to import json is "2FA Manager", but alas it doesn't seem to recognize the json format from andOTP. Does anyone know if there are good, reliable alternatives for those 2 apps? Thanks 🙂

        @mtlmaks said in Daily Driver:

        but alas it doesn't seem to recognize the json format from andOTP

        Did the app give an error? Can you check the log? It's more useful to open an issue on the app repo project than here 🙂

        Also, does andOTP export keys in plain text?
        If it does, you can import those in 2FA Manager

        Even better, if you know the format of the exported json open an issue here
        https://gitlab.com/cibersheep/tfamanager/-/issues

        Just the scheme would be needed (careful not to share personal info nor keys)
